Identifying Common Signs of Water Leaks in Kitchen Environments
Detecting water leaks in commercial kitchens requires awareness of specific indicators that could signal a problem. Observing unusual moisture around appliances and plumbing fixtures is a primary concern. Water pooling on the floor or cabinets is a red flag that should not be ignored, as it can lead to slippery surfaces and health code risks.
Another sign to monitor is the presence of mold or mildew. These fungi thrive in damp conditions and can signal persistent leaks. Inspecting for discoloration on walls or ceilings can also be informative; yellow or brown stains often indicate water intrusion from above.
Unusual sounds, such as dripping or running water when no fixtures are in use, can suggest leaks within the plumbing system. Additionally, fluctuating water bills may indicate hidden leaks, warranting further investigation. Incorporating water monitoring systems can help identify leaks early, minimizing damage and ensuring compliance with health regulations.
Regular inspections of appliances, including dishwashers and ice machines, as well as monitoring drain lines, are effective practices in leak detection. Addressing these signs promptly can safeguard both the kitchen environment and the establishment’s operational integrity.
Implementing Regular Inspection Routines for Leak Detection
Establishing routine inspections is key to maintaining integrity in food service plumbing systems. Regular checks help identify minor issues such as floor drain leaks, which can escalate into significant problems if overlooked. Scheduling these inspections allows kitchen managers to detect hidden pipe damage before it becomes apparent.
In addition to visual inspections, implementing water monitoring systems can enhance leak detection capabilities. These systems provide real-time data, alerting staff to any unusual patterns that may indicate a leak, such as a grease trap overflow or a sudden spike in water usage.
Training staff to recognize early signs of leaks, coupled with a proactive inspection routine, ensures compliance with safety standards. Addressing issues quickly minimizes potential disruptions in service and protects the kitchen environment. Utilizing Technology for Real-Time Water Leak Monitoring
In commercial kitchens and restaurants, technology plays a key role in safeguarding operations against water leaks. Implementing advanced monitoring systems allows for the detection of issues before they escalate, particularly in high-usage areas.
Real-time water leak detection systems use sensors strategically placed near potential problem areas, such as:
- Pipes prone to hidden pipe damage
- Grease trap overflow points
- Near floor drains that might leak
These sensors are designed to immediately alert staff to any signs of water leaks, facilitating rapid response. This not only protects the kitchen environment but also enhances safety compliance standards.
Utilizing IoT (Internet of Things) technology, businesses can integrate water leak monitoring with their existing systems. Data collected from sensors can be analyzed to track historical trends, helping identify recurring issues and optimize maintenance schedules.
Additionally, mobile applications can provide notifications and detailed reports, empowering kitchen managers to take timely actions and minimize downtime. By investing in these technologies, restaurants can ensure a safer and more efficient kitchen environment.
